titleOfInvention Moisture-proof paper
abstract P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ide moisture-proof performance (JIS Z-0208) higher than that of laminated paper, good disaggregation at the time of regeneration, high moisture-proof coating surface / back surface, back / back surface friction coefficient, and moisture-proof moisture resistance Provide paper. SOLUTION: A moisture-proof paper having a moisture-proof layer made of a moisture-proof agent containing a synthetic resin emulsion (A) for moisture-proof processing formed on one side of a paper substrate, and a particulate filler on the other side of the moisture-proof paper A moisture-proof paper, characterized in that an anti-slip layer comprising an anti-slip agent comprising (D) and a synthetic rubber latex (E) is formed.
